Output 75af76abd625bba0c224cd353b85c9b8b2757d38dc6186af0b8ba0c389bea233:2

value
26858816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46de754487c8c754ae743dcd8fd910c9fd2e9f0a OP_EQUAL
address
389jidViW9TM4RuBgoX1eAts9PXhoQejEd
transaction
75af76abd625bba0c224cd353b85c9b8b2757d38dc6186af0b8ba0c389bea233
spent
true